      Anyone looking for a seemingly simple project that would be very useful???

      Seemingly, because I have no clue..... 😛

      I would love to see a plugin/script that would sequentially place numbers at a set height wherever you clicked on a model. You would also need to be able to set the start number (1,2,3... or 25,26,27,28... etc).

      I am looking to number lots on site plans. There is a script available for AutoCad called 'lotno' that has the exact functionality I am looking for, with the exception of specifying the Z value.

                    Hi,

                    Here is the first attempt to code what you want (I hope).

                    Usage:

                    Unzip the archive and place NumberingText.rbs in your Plugins folder
                    Restart SketchUp

                    Select 'Numbering Text' in the 'Extensions' menu
                    Fill the dialog
                    Prefix will precede the number (you can include spaces and \n sequence)
                    Suffix will follow the number (you can include spaces and \n sequence)
                    N.B.: a \n sequence in a text will reject the rest of the text on a new line.
                    Altitude will be the height of all the texts above ground

                    Click to insert label(s) , Right-clic to change settings, Escape to cancel, Return to end the tool.

                          I'm afraid I can't 😳 . Unfortunately text entities in SketchUp are very basic (as opposed to text in Layout), and they do not have justification properties (because they are automatically left or right justified, depending on the arrow and pin features).
                          I've tried to move the text a little to the left, but this translation depends on the text font and text height, it never gives a good result. A workaround would be to click slighty to the left of the location you want, knowing how long the text is, how big the font is, etc.
                          Best regards,

                          EDIT: I found that using 3DText will do the trick. I'll investigate this 😉

                              Here is the second attempt, with it you can insert either 2D texts (like before) and 3D texts (these will be centered on your clicks.

                              Install:
                              Unzip the archive and place Numbering2D3DText.rbs in your Plugins folder (remove any old version)
                              Restart SketchUp, select your option (2D or 3D) in the Draw menu

                              2D Text Usage:

                              Fill the dialog:

                              • Prefix will precede the number (you can include spaces,\n or \t sequences)
                              • Suffix will follow the number (you can include spaces,\n or \t sequences)
                              • Text altitude will be the height (in your current units) of all the texts, above ground (you can use negative values)
                              • Click to insert label(s) , Right-clic to change settings, Escape to cancel, Return to end the tool.

                              3D Text Usage:

                              Fill the dialog:

                              • Prefix will precede the number (you CANNOT include spaces,\n or \t sequences)
                              • Suffix will follow the number (you CANNOT include spaces,\n or \t sequences)
                              • Text altitude will be the height (in your current units) of all the texts, above ground (you can use negative values)
                              • Text font: enter a font name like Arial, Verdana, Tahoma, Times New Roman, etc.
                              • Font Height: the height of the characters, in your current units
                              • Extrude: the width (or depth) of the characters
                              • Click to insert label(s) , Right-clic to change settings, Escape to cancel, Return to end the tool.

                              N.B.: 3D texts will be centered around the points you click, in top view.

                                            I see at least 1 missing feature. The text label layer.
                                            (Imagine having to select all those text objects to change their layer?)

                                            Workaround is to create and change to a "Text" layer (named whatever you please) before creating the text.
